Can Spurs Win the Premier League for Mourinho?

At the top of the Premier League nine matches in, the players at Tottenham Hotspur have every reason to be cheerful with their outstanding team performance and fans have started to think the unthinkable: can Spurs win the Premier League this season?

After the north London team’s latest victory – a 2-0 win against Manchester City on Saturday – Manager Jose Mourinho urged caution saying “It feels good, but maybe tomorrow we are second again and honestly that would not be a problem for me, I am just happy with the evolution.  People cannot expect us to come here and after one season we are fighting for the title.  We are not fighting for the title, we are just fighting to win every match. But we are going to lose matches, we are going to draw matches”. 

Mourinho has been in post for only one year, having replaced Mauricio Pochettino, and his confident management at White Hart Lane is a major contrast with his lacklustre performance at Manchester United where he was sacked after a dismal start to the 2018/19 season.  Flashy players like Ryan Essegnon and Dele Alli have been ditched or relegated to the bench in favour of grafters who work hard for the team such as Carlos Vinicius, Sergio Reguilon and Joe Rodon.  Not forgetting two stars of the game – Harry Kane, striker and captain of England (also man of the match this weekend) and Gareth Bale, on loan from Real Madrid, who is still fighting for a regular place on the team sheet.

With 29 matches still to play, there are sure to be bumps on the road but some pundits are already tipping Spurs to win the Premier League and the bookies are taking note of the team’s brilliant start to the season with the odds for Spurs lifting the trophy now at 6/1 with the Betfair Exchange.

But Liverpool, also on 20 points but behind Spurs on goal difference,  remain favourites for the title with odds of 6/4 from Betfair and Smarkets.  The Reds, managed by Jurgen Klopp, won last season’s title by a country mile, and they were runners-up the previous season.  They are a force to be reckoned with and Tottenham players will need to keep performing at their highest level to remain in contention.  

Manchester City also remain ahead of Spurs in the betting, with odds of 11/4 from BetVictor, despite being at only 13th place in the League just now.  City are 8 points adrift but have plenty of time to fight their way back.  With 2 Premier League titles and one second placing in the past three years, there is plenty of experience in the Manchester City team to deliver a major turnaround in their fortunes.

Winning the Premier League would be enormous for Tottenham Hotspur, after a hiatus of 12 years, but Harry Kane echoes Mourinho when he commented on recent performance, saying “We are doing well.  I still think there are parts of our season we can improve on, for sure.  Obviously, we are top of the league now but we know we have a lot of tough games to go”.    It’s not going to be a one-horse race as it was last season but Spurs are playing great football under Mourinho and the team has a realistic chance to win the Premier League next spring.
